FRSH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2025 in Review

328 of the 8,223 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Freshworks (FRSH) for Q4 2025, worth a combined $2.58B — up 7.3% from $2.41B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 64 funds opened new FRSH positions and 41 closed out — a net gain of 23 holders — while 123 added to existing stakes and 105 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Citadel Advisors, adding an estimated $47.8M. The largest seller was JP Morgan Chase, cutting an estimated $50.9M.
